1. Spot Early Hydraulic Warning Signs

Hydraulic systems whisper before they scream, making early detection critical for machinery health.

By identifying hydraulic warning signs early, operators can intervene before minor component wear cascades into a catastrophic system failure.

Preventable machinery failures cost the industry heavily, with billions lost due to unexpected delays and excessive downtime.

Upon noticing any early symptoms, the most cost-effective decision is to shut the machine down and investigate immediately.

Timely intervention remains the best defense against rapidly escalating repair costs.

The most common early indicators require simple visual and auditory checks around the equipment.

Operators should train their eyes and ears to catch these subtle shifts during regular operation. Look for these specific hydraulic warning signs during every shift:

  • External weeping or misting at the rod seals
  • Sluggish or jerky cylinder movement during standard operation
  • A whining pump under load when the hydraulic oil is hot
  • Milky or dark-colored hydraulic oil indicates contamination or water ingress
Important: Don’t ignore a whining pump or milky oil. What starts as a $50 seal replacement can become a $5,000 pump failure if you keep running.

2. Create a Simple Preventive Inspection Routine

You do not need a massive fleet management team to run a tight inspection schedule.

Establishing a brief, repeatable preventive inspection routine is widely considered one of the most practical backhoe maintenance tips for small to mid-sized contractors.

Research shows that establishments relying heavily on reactive maintenance face 3.3 times more machinery failure periods than those using proactive approaches.

A simple five-minute morning walk-around shifts the daily operational mindset from reactive panic to planned repair work.

Before the engine warms up, check the hydraulic oil levels and inspect hoses and fittings for outer cover abrasion.

Examine the cylinder rod condition for pitting or scoring, test linkage and pin points for excessive play, and verify the overall health of breathers and filters.

Catching a ruptured hose before it bursts under high pressure saves hours of cleanup and fluid replacement later in the shift.

Consistency in these daily checks proves far more effective than occasional deep inspections. This steady habit is the foundational element of any functional maintenance program.

3. Keep Common Wear Parts on Hand

A minor repair only becomes a job-halting crisis when the correct part is out of reach. Effective hydraulic repair planning requires maintaining a curated inventory of highly consumable items directly on the job site or in the primary service truck.

Current statistics show that industrial maintenance practices still lean heavily on reactive maintenance, leading to unnecessary delays.

Building a lean spare parts list empowers operators to handle standard maintenance without leaving the site.

Essential inventory should include seal kit replacement components for frequently used cylinders like the boom, arm, and bucket.

Additionally, stock assorted O-rings, hydraulic caps, and plugs to seal lines during service, a test gauge capable of reading up to 5,000 PSI, and spare quick-connect couplers.

Having brand-compatible kits on hand minimizes the friction of mid-shift repairs regardless of the machinery brand.

When the parts are already in the toolbox, a bleeding seal can be serviced during a standard lunch break rather than halting work for two days. This level of readiness directly protects tight project margins.

To put these sourcing and maintenance strategies into motion, utilize a highly skimmable checklist during your morning walk-around.

This checklist ensures no critical component is missed during the rush of a busy morning on site.

  • Check the hydraulic oil sight glass for correct levels and no milky coloring
  • Ensure cylinder rods are dry and free of scoring or pitting
  • Verify hoses are free of outer cover damage, cracking, or active rubbing
  • Test for cylinder drift while the engine is turned off
  • Confirm all heavy-friction grease points are properly serviced
